debian

Debian下Telnet如何加密传输

小樊
34
2025-05-30 06:55:44
栏目: 网络安全

在Debian下,Telnet默认是不加密的,但你可以使用SSH(Secure Shell)来加密传输。SSH是一种加密的网络协议,用于在不安全的网络上进行安全的远程登录和其他网络服务。要在Debian下使用SSH加密传输,请按照以下步骤操作:

  1. 安装SSH服务器: 打开终端,输入以下命令来安装OpenSSH服务器:

    sudo apt-get update
    sudo apt-get install openssh-server
    
  2. 启动并启用SSH服务: 使用以下命令启动SSH服务:

    sudo systemctl start ssh
    

    要使SSH服务在系统启动时自动运行,请输入:

    sudo systemctl enable ssh
    
  3. 配置SSH服务器: 编辑SSH配置文件 /etc/ssh/sshd_config,根据需要进行调整。例如,你可以更改默认端口、禁用密码登录等。以下是一个简单的示例:

    Port 2222
    PermitRootLogin no
    PasswordAuthentication yes
    

    保存文件并退出编辑器。

  4. 重启SSH服务: 输入以下命令以应用更改:

    sudo systemctl restart ssh
    
  5. 连接到SSH服务器: 在客户端计算机上,打开终端并输入以下命令来连接到Debian服务器(将your_username替换为实际的用户名,将your_server_ip替换为实际的服务器IP地址):

    ssh your_username@your_server_ip
    

    如果一切正常,你将看到一个加密的连接提示。输入密码后,你将登录到Debian服务器。

现在,你已经成功地在Debian下使用SSH加密传输了。请注意,SSH默认使用端口22,但你可以根据需要在配置文件中更改端口。

0
看了该问题的人还看了